CVE-2023-26369
Adobe Acrobat and Reader Out-of-Bounds Write Vulne - [Actively Exploited]
Description

Acrobat Reader versions 23.003.20284 (and earlier), 20.005.30516 (and earlier) and 20.005.30514 (and earlier) are affected by an out-of-bounds write vulnerability that could result in arbitrary code execution in the context of the current user. Exploitation of this issue requires user interaction in that a victim must open a malicious file.
